首页>>后端>>Python->django怎么设置admin密码(2023年最新分享)

django怎么设置admin密码(2023年最新分享)

时间:2023-12-15 本站 点击:0

导读:本篇文章首席CTO笔记来给大家介绍有关django怎么设置admin密码的相关内容,希望对大家有所帮助,一起来看看吧。

Django如何重设Admin密码

createsuperuser来甚至密码,但是如果你忘记了Admin的密码的话,那么就要用Django shell:python manage.py shell然后获取你的用户名,并且重设密码:from django.contrib.auth.models import Useruser =User.objects.get(username='admin')user.set_password('new_password')这样之后你就可以使用新的密码登入了。

Django 1.74 版本取消 syncdb 后,请问怎么创建 admin 账号

1 利用"Administrator"

我们知道在安装WIN XP过程中,首先是以"Administrator"默认登陆,然后会要求创建一个新帐户,以便进入WIN XP时使用此新建帐号,而且在WIN XP的登陆界面中也只会出现创建的这个用户帐户,不会出现 "Administrator",但实际上该"Administrator"帐号还是存在的,并且密码为空.

当我们了解了这一点以后,假如忘记了登陆密码的话,在登陆界面上,按住Ctrl+Alt键,再按住Del键两次,即可出现经典的登陆画面,此时在用户名处键入"Administrator",密码为空进入,然后再修改"ZHANGBQ"的密码即可.

2 利用NET命令

我们知道在WIN XP中提供了"net user"命令,该命令可以添加,修改用户帐户信息,其语法格式为:

net user[UserName[Password|*][options]][/domain]

net user[UserName{Password|*}/add[options][/domain]

net user[UserName[/delete][/domain]]

每个参数的具体含义在WIN XP帮助中已做了详细的说明,在此笔者就不多阐述了.好了,我们现在以恢复本地用户"zhangbq"口令为例,来说明解决忘记登陆密码的步骤:

1 重新启动计算机,在启动画面出现后马上按下F8键,选择"带命令行的安全模式".

2 运行过程结束时,系统列出了系统超级用户"Administrator"和本地用户"ZHANGBQ"的选择菜单,鼠标单击"Administrator",进入命令行模式.

3 键入命令:"net user zhangbq 123456/add",强制将"zhangbq"用户的口令更改为"123456".若想在此添加一个新用户(如:用户名为"abcdef",口令为"123456")的话,请键入"net user abcdef 123456/add",添加后可用 "net localgroup administrators abcdef/add"命令将用户提升为系统管理组"Administrator"的用户,并使其具有超级权限.

4 重新启动计算机,选择正常模式下运行,就可以用更改后的口令"123456"登陆"ZHANGBQ"用户了.

在pycharm下创建Django项目,其中有admin的用户名和密码

在命令行输入

python manage.py createsuperuser

按照提示输入即可

记得先初始化表。

django1.7

python manage.py makemigrations

python manage.py migrate

django1.7

python manage.py syncdb

结语:以上就是首席CTO笔记为大家介绍的关于django怎么设置admin密码的全部内容了,希望对大家有所帮助,如果你还想了解更多这方面的信息,记得收藏关注本站。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/Python/36082.html